spring什么意思中文意思是什么意思啊
-
Spring是一种编程框架,用于简化Java开发的过程。它提供了许多开发工具和功能,可以帮助开发者快速构建企业级应用程序。Spring的主要特点包括依赖注入(DI)、面向切面编程(AOP)、轻量级和松耦合等。
Spring的中文意思是“春天”,这个名称取自于春天给人带来希望、新生和活力的含义。与此相符,Spring框架也被设计成一个轻量级、易于使用和灵活的框架,能够提供强大的开发支持,并促使开发者写出高效、可维护的代码。
总之,Spring是一个功能强大的框架,它在Java开发中具有广泛的应用。它能够帮助开发者更加高效地开发和管理应用程序,提供了大量的工具和功能来简化开发过程。同时,Spring也强调了代码的可维护性和可测试性,使得应用程序具有更好的性能和可扩展性。
1年前 -
Spring是一个开源的应用框架,用于Java平台上的企业级应用程序开发。它提供了一套全面的解决方案,包括依赖注入、面向切面编程、事务管理、Web开发等功能。Spring框架的目标是简化企业应用程序的开发,提高开发效率,并使应用程序更加易于测试、维护和扩展。
Spring框架有以下几个特点:
-
轻量级:Spring框架的核心容器非常轻量,仅仅是一个基本的IoC容器,它不依赖于其他的第三方库。因此,使用Spring框架不会增加额外的开销。而且,Spring框架的依赖注入机制也为应用程序的模块化和松耦合提供了支持。
-
模块化:Spring框架由多个独立的模块组成,每个模块都可以单独使用,也可以组合在一起使用。这种模块化的特性使得Spring框架非常灵活,开发人员可以根据需要选择合适的模块来构建应用程序。
-
面向切面编程(AOP):Spring框架支持面向切面编程,可以将横切关注点(如日志记录、性能统计等)从业务逻辑中解耦出来,提高代码的可重用性和可维护性。
-
与其他框架的整合:Spring框架可以与其他流行的框架进行整合,例如Struts、Hibernate、MyBatis等。这样一来,开发人员可以利用Spring框架来管理这些框架的配置和生命周期,简化应用程序的开发和维护。
-
测试支持:Spring框架提供了广泛的测试支持,可以方便地进行单元测试和集成测试。这样一来,开发人员可以更快地发现和修复问题,确保应用程序的稳定性和可靠性。
总的来说,Spring框架是一个功能强大、灵活易用的企业级应用框架,可以大大简化Java应用程序的开发过程,提高开发效率和代码质量。
1年前 -
-
Spring是一个用于构建企业级应用程序的开源Java框架。它提供了丰富的功能和组件,使开发者能够更轻松地开发高效、可靠和可扩展的应用程序。
Spring框架在企业应用开发中有广泛的应用,它的目标是为了简化开发过程,提高开发效率,并且使应用程序更易于测试和维护。
Spring框架的关键特性包括:
-
控制反转(IoC):通过IoC容器,Spring框架实现了对象的依赖管理。开发者只需定义对象的依赖关系,而不需要手动实例化和管理对象。框架负责在运行时将对象注入到需要它们的地方。
-
切面编程(AOP):Spring框架支持AOP,可以在程序中实现横切关注点的模块化。例如,可以通过AOP将应用程序中的日志记录、事务管理、性能监控等功能从核心业务逻辑中剥离出来,并以可重复使用的方式进行配置和管理。
-
面向接口编程:Spring鼓励面向接口的编程风格,通过接口对外部模块进行解耦,使得模块之间的依赖更加灵活和可替换。
-
组件化开发:Spring框架提供了一种组件化的开发方式,允许开发者将应用程序拆分成各个独立的模块(如控制器、服务、数据访问等),并且能够方便地进行组装和管理。
Spring框架还提供了大量的扩展模块和集成解决方案,如Spring MVC用于开发Web应用程序,Spring Boot用于快速构建独立的Spring应用程序,Spring Data用于简化数据库访问等。
总的来说,Spring框架通过提供一系列功能和组件,可以帮助开发者更高效地构建企业级Java应用程序。
1年前 -